Com esotericsoftware kryo ioe

But when the byte arrays are converted into the objects, it throws, otericsoftware. Kryoexception we visualize these cases as a tree for easy understanding. If you use this library as an alternative serialization method when sending messages between actors, it is extremely important that the order of class registration and the assigned class ids are the same for senders and for receivers. I am currently encountering the following exception. How to do kryo arraylist deserialization stack overflow. Im new to kryo serialization and want to do some binary serialization and.

Clientserver library for java, based on netty and kryo java bsd3clause 15 40 0 0 updated may 14, 2014. You can click to vote up the examples that are useful to you. It is already on attempt 6 for stage 7 id try to find out why attempt 0 failed. Spark uses javaserialization by default, but it is very slow compared to, say, kryo. During startup atlas tries to populate the backend database with default type information. It is first introduced in snapdragon 820 2015 and has been featured in subsequent upperrange snapdragon socs ever since. Hadoop does not have this problem because it binaryserializes the whole. The goals of the project are speed, efficiency, and an easy to use api. The following are top voted examples for showing how to use otericsoftware.

So we use kryo to do that by using a wrapper spark doesnt support kryo serde for closures, not yet. Qualcomm kryo is a series of custom or semicustom armbased cpus included in the snapdragon line of socs. We provide free statistics on which apps and games are using these libraries, and a full list of apps can be purchased for a small fee. Fyi im using 3 hadoop nodes as datanode and tasktracker, the operation creating 2 separated job, first job. This hashmap is not an object field, but is being serialized by itself. If true, an exception is thrown when an unregistered class is encountered. This page provides java code examples for otericsoftware. Kryo is a fast and efficient object graph serialization framework for java. The goals of the project are high speed, low size, and an easy to use api. The following code examples are extracted from open source projects. Sign up for a free github account to open an issue and contact its maintainers and the community.

Kryo exception releated to buffer overflow while sending tasks to satellite. Kryonet is a java library that provides a clean and simple api for efficient tcp and udp clientserver network communication using nio. Dont get a serializer and use it directly, instead pass it to the kryo methods that take a serializer. Looking at the stack trace it appears that titandb is having trouble initializing. The following examples show how to use otericsoftware. These cpus implement the armv8a 64bit instruction set, and serve as the successor to the previous 32bit krait cpus. Kryo can also perform automatic deep and shallow copyingcloning.

Nevertheless, when the issue occurs, i see in the debugger that the generics fields are set on the mapserialzier, which causes the class information not to be written during serialization. This is the 5th release candidate of the new major version of kryo see also the rc1 release notes for major changes of v5 this rc comes with several improvements over the previous rcs, e. Kryo is the central place for serialization to go through, enabling it to do more. We place your stack trace on this tree so you can find similar ones. If false, when an unregistered class is encountered, its fully qualified class name will be serialized and the default serializer for the class used to serialize the object. Looks like this exception is after many more failures have occurred. Writing references is better supported and enabled by default. If you look at the stack traces you see that objects get serialized that obviously. Central 12 spring plugins 2 archive 1 icm 3 version repository usages date. These examples are extracted from open source projects. It occurs when i am trying to serialize a hashmap with 5 values.

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. The project is useful any time objects need to be persisted, whether to a file, database, or over the network. Schematypeimpl, which finally results in the serialization of a classloader. Please use the kryonet discussion group for support overview. This contains the shaded reflectasm jar to prevent conflicts with other versions of asmlast version kryo shaded4. Im new to kryo serialization and want to do some binary serialization and deserialization using an array list. Subsequent appearances of the class within the same object graph are serialized as an int id.

357 181 508 5 121 851 940 897 1342 706 695 1213 231 1067 1514 665 182 965 1091 1039 452 976 766 178 1468 211 615 205 344 190 1445 68 404 643 190 503 1404 542 1164 423 644 245 532 676 189 362